Lawmakers in Juneau are racing to get funding for faster internet for rural Alaska schools.

House members just passed House Bill 193. The bill would provide rural schools with up to nearly $40 million in state aid, matching federal funds, to improve their internet service, the Alaska Beacon reported.

March 27 is the federal deadline for districts to apply for this funding. That means the Senate and the governor have just days to pass the bill.
